More about the book
The author explores the interconnectedness of political philosophy and political economy, emphasizing concepts like taxation theory, expectation theory, and praxeology. The text argues that civilization evolves from the establishment of expectation theory, with law representing a refined form of expectation. Citizens base their actions on a network of "objective" expectations, influencing market systems and welfare. A society rich in expectations allows individuals to prioritize immediate gratification, leading to higher time preferences as they seek to alleviate unease and achieve satisfaction.
